The Naval Surface Warfare Center, Dahlgren Division (NSWC DD) requires one Series SFC, 100kva, with installation services. The contractor shall provide one unit of the specified model, ensuring it meets requirements including 12 pulse PWM solid-state technology, double conversion topology, galvanic electrical isolation, and specific output frequency and voltage regulation. OEM specifications are applicable documents.

The bid is for the Main Street Bridge over Dan River Rehabilitation Project. A pre-bid meeting is scheduled for February 25, 2026, at 10:00 AM. The last day for questions is March 13, 2026, at 5:00 PM. Bids open on March 31, 2026, at 2:00 PM. The project involves various construction services, including bridge deck grooving, concrete work, railing reconstruction, and the application of an activated arc spray zinc system. The contractor must provide a performance bond and a labor and material bond. The work must commence within five days of the written notice to proceed. Liquidated damages are **** per day for delays. The bid is subject to acceptance within 90 days. A certified pavement marking technician must be present during all temporary and permanent pavement marking operations.
The work under this contract shall commence not later than five 5 consecutive calendar days after the date of a written notice to proceed is given by the city to the contractor.
The contractor shall provide a oneyear warranty from the date of final acceptance on all thmaco surfaces.
The city reserves the right to reject any or all bids or waive any defects in favor of the city.
The metalizing contractor installing the metalized coating shall have a minimum of three years of previous experience in metalizing operations in concrete.
The amount of liquidated damage, as stipulated in the specifications, shall be six hundred dollars **** for each day, including saturdays, sundays, and holidays, after the established dates for substantial completion and final completion.
The bidder further declares that they have examined the site of the work and informed themselves fully in regard to all conditions pertaining to the place where the work is to be done.

The project involves repairing and recapitalizing Wharf Bravo and associated utilities at NAS Pensacola, Florida. The solicitation will be a negotiated dbb acquisition. The best value tradeoff process will be used for this acquisition. A site visit will be held, and proposals will be due no earlier than 30 days after the solicitation is released. Large business concerns will be required to submit a subcontracting plan prior to award of the contract.
The bid notice states that the solicitation and contract shall include far clause **** 10, commence, prosecution and completion of work, which will identify 665 calendar days base and any options exercised for contract completion from date of contract award.
The bid notice states that award will be made to the offeror whose total price and technical proposal offers the best value to the government.
The bid notice states that a site visit will be held for those offerors who choose to participate exact date and time will be specified in the solicitation.
The estimated project magnitude is between $25,000,000 and $100,000,000.
